About the Position

We’re looking for an experienced Project Controls Engineer to support large, complex civil construction projects in the aviation sector. In this role, you’ll play a key part in managing project schedules, budgets, and documentation while preparing and delivering comprehensive project performance reports and analyses.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, have strong analytical and reporting skills, and are ready to contribute to high-profile infrastructure projects, we want to hear from you!

This is a long-term, full-time, hybrid (2-3 days/wk in office) position located in Queens, NY.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are and coordinate monthly progress reports and ad hoc reports in collaboration with project task leaders.
  • Provide support to discipline leads (cost, schedule, and contracts) with various project controls functions as needed.
  • Prepare and deliver reports on project progress, scheduling, budgeting, construction costs, and contractor performance for both short- and long-term planning purposes.
  • Coordinate and develop monthly progress and ad hoc reports in collaboration with project task leaders.
  • Support discipline leads (cost, schedule, and contracts) with project controls functions, including scope, schedule, and budget management.
  • Assist with the development and review of construction and CPM schedules to ensure compliance with project requirements.
  • Evaluate and process contract payment requests on a monthly basis, including cost estimation and management of change orders.
  • Manage and organize project documentation to support project controls and change order management efforts.
  • Research project documentation (e.g., plan sets) to define project milestones and sequencing.
  • Read and analyze project diaries to assign WBS codes and assist in creating as-built CPM schedules.
  • Assist with issue resolution and claims documentation to support project success and compliance.
  • Ensure consistent and accurate reporting to the Program Controls Manager.
